Casio E03CA Cell Phone

Casio E03CA Cell Phone

After convergence, toughness seems to be the new mantra of cell phone manufacturers. Casio unleashed the new E03CA cell phone, boasting high levels of waterproof efficiency as well as embodying a shock-resistant body.

Casio entered the cell phone business in 2000, and made a mark for itself with the G'zOne Type R phone. The E03CA includes Bluetooth support and a camera, with a largish 2.4" QVGA screen (main display). The phone is compatible with CDMA 1X EV-DO standard, so watch out for high-speed data access on this baby.

Battery life is claimed at 380 hours on standby and 300 minutes of talk-time. The Casio E03CA weighs in at 166 grams - a bit on the heavier side for those used to the RAZR and its clones. It supports MicroSD memory cards for expanding on the available memory.

The Casio E03CA cell phone is now available to KDDI customers in Japan.

    Casio G'zOne W42CA Cell Phone

    Casio Upgrades G'zOne, Calls It G'zOne W42CACasio's G'zOne has just had a makeover, and now includes more features and functionality than before. The G'zOne W42CA is water-resistant and shockproof, like its predecessor, but they have been enhanced to new levels. In addition, the G'zOne W42CA includes, for the first time, CDMA1X WIN compatibility for the latest in high-speed communications and services.

    Now, with enhanced toughness, you can enjoy music-on-demand and other such services. The G'zOne W42CA includes a big 2.4" QVGA LCD display, with an auto-focus 2 mega-pixel camera, 50MB on-board memory and support for expansion via microSD cards.

    Compatible with Listen Mobile Service (LISMO), Casio claims a 15-hour music playback on this baby, and when used in conjunction with a GPS, you can use its map-loading facilities to get driving directions. The new G'zOne W42CA has a futuristic look and feel to it.

    Available in Volcano Orange, Glacier White (my personal fav) and Manaus Green, the pricing and availability of Casio G'zOne W42CA cell phone will be announced soon.

    Casio W21CA Cell Phone coming to the US

    Engadget.com Reports that some Japanese made 3G Casio Cell Phones, including the Casio W21CA, will be coming to the USA. The Casio phones maybe carried by Sprint Nextel Corp and Verizon Wireless. These Casio phones look really cool.


    Some features of the Casio W21CA include:

  • Waterproof and shock-resistant
  • 3G phone.
  • CDMA 1x EV-DO with top speeds of 2.4Mbps.
  • 2.6" QVGA screen.
  • Opera web browser.
